Why You Should Learn PCB Design
Printed circuit boards are at the heart of all modern electronic devices. Without PCBs, modern electronics would not be possible. PCBs are relatively easy to design and are cheap to manufacture. As a result, learning PCB design can be an excellent career move as well as a worthwhile personal undertaking.
Learn a Marketable Skill
PCB design is a fascinating subject and while studying it, you will learn a lot about modern electronics and how they are designed. However, learning PCB design is not just an intellectual pursuit; this is a skill that is highly marketable and can easily form the basis of a long-term career.
You don’t need us to tell you that electronic devices are all around us in the modern world. Every one of these devices, no matter how simple or complex, has to be designed by an electronics designer. This process begins with the design of the printed circuit board that sits at the heart of every modern electronic device.
Take Your DIY Electronics to the Next Level
If you aren’t looking for a new career, but are instead interested in PCB design as a hobby, then it still has a huge amount to offer you. For example, if you have previously used a Raspberry Pi or Arduino and found those fun, then learning about PCB design will enable you to take your microcontroller experience to the next level.
Once you learn to design your own printed circuit boards, you can then begin to design some relatively complicated electronic devices with ease. Given just how cheap and easy printed circuit boards are to order these days, you can easily turn these designs into a reality.
The Resources Are Freely Available
Many people assume that designing the circuit boards that power electronic devices must be an incredibly complicated process. While complicated electronics obviously have complicated engineering behind them, there are also plenty of very simple electronic devices out there. Designing PCB for simple devices is actually quite easy.
Not only is this a more accessible topic than many people realize, but all of the resources and tools that you need to start getting involved are freely available online. You can find tutorials online for everything from designing your first printed circuit board, up to using Altium PCB special strings. You don’t need to pay a cent to start learning PCB design.
